Bayesian Optimization: Tuning Expensive Black-Box Functions
Some functions cost hours or dollars to evaluate once and give no gradient, so you must find their optimum in as few tries as possible. This path builds the standard method for that: why grid and random search waste the budget, how a Gaussian process predicts the objective and its uncertainty everywhere, how acquisition functions like Expected Improvement and the no-regret GP-UCB of Srinivas, Krause, Kakade, and Seeger decide where to look next, and how the tools work in practice.
